Full job description

Job DetailsJob Location: Colorado Springs, CO 80915Position Type: Full TimeEducation Level: 4 Year DegreeSalary Range: $45,000.00 - $55,000.00 Salary/yearThe Assessment and Intervention Coordinator plans and implements school-wide local, district, and state assessment programs for students at Power Technical. Additionally, this role analyzes student data to develop and implement intervention plans to support students and teachers. The Assessment and Intervention Coordinator leads Response to Intervention meetings and plans, develops and implements 504 Accommodation Plans, and implements and supports Culturally and Linguistically Diverse Learner Plans.

Essential Functions

Oversee and participate in organizing, administering, monitoring, scoring, processing and data analysis of local, district, and state assessment programs. Serve as the liaison to district staff and outside vendors regarding assessment. Ensure assessment activities comply with related standards and requirements. Assessments administered include (but are not limited to): NWEA MAPS, Acadience Reading, ACCESS, ASVAB, ACCUPlacer, CMAS, PSAT, and SAT.

Participate in the accurate input of student assessment results, intervention plans, and a variety of other data into appropriate databases; initiate inquiries and generate reports; purge files as necessary.

Plan and facilitate professional development and training for staff involved in assessments for the purpose of meeting district needs and to ensure compliance with federal, state, and district requirements.

Participate in meetings, workshops, training and seminars for the purpose of conveying and/or gathering information required to perform functions.

Analyze academic and assessment data to identify and develop support plans for students in compliance with district, state and federal laws. This includes Response to Intervention Plans, 504 Accommodation Plans, and Culturally and Linguistically Diverse Learner Plans.

Provide individualized academic and executive functioning supports to students as part of intervention plan management.

As dictated by school needs, provide instruction in up to 2 classes per semester.

Act as a source of information to students, faculty and staff, and the public regarding assessments, policies, requirements, and procedures.

Act as a source of information to students, faculty and staff, and the public regarding accommodation plans and student support services, policies, requirements, and procedures.

EMPLOYMENT STANDARDS

Education and Experience: Completion of a bachelor’s degree. At least 5 years of experience as a classroom teacher or in a role responsible for instruction of students. Experience that would demonstrate proficiency in administering or monitoring assessment sessions and records management techniques or a combination of training or experience that would indicate the possession of the knowledge, skills, and abilities indicated in the job description.

Knowledge

Knowledge of methods of collecting and organizing data and information, statistical methods in assessment, assessment processes, educational programs and organizations, records management techniques, and legal requirements relating to assessment and student accommodation plans. Knowledge of current office management practices including filing systems, letter and report writing, presentation techniques, and a variety of word processing, spreadsheet, or database programs as needed to fulfill the requirements of the job. Public and human relations skills. Knowledge of instructional techniques and practices, education law, and development and implementation of accommodation plans.

Abilities

Ability to coordinate, plan and organize work; gather, analyze, and interpret test results; learn, understand, apply and communicate applicable laws, rules, regulations, procedures, and policies; maintain current information regarding assigned programs and tasks; prioritize tasks and do several tasks simultaneously; conduct assessment activities; schedule a significant number of activities and/or events; provide individualized supports to students and families.

Flexibility is required to independently work with others in a wide variety of circumstances. Independent problem solving is required to analyze issues and create action plans. Problem solving with data requires analysis based on organizational objectives. Must be able to independently carry out oral and written instructions, compile and maintain accurate and complete records, analyze and present academic and assessment data, efficiently prepare reports and correspondence.

Utilize word processing, spreadsheet, and database programs to create/produce letters, reports, and other documents as needed. Communicate effectively in both written and verbal form. Conduct and facilitate professional development and meetings.

Exercise sound judgement in recognizing the scope of authority as designated. Analyze situations and make decisions on procedural and detail matters without immediate supervision. Train and provide direction to staff and students.

Exempt

Salary Range $45,000 - $55,000 annually depending on experience. 191 contract days annually.

James Irwin Charter Schools is a network of six charter schools in Colorado Springs, Colorado named after the late Apollo 15 Astronaut James Benson Irwin. Founded in 2000, it has four campuses and nearly 2,000 students. The mission of James Irwin Charter Schools is to help guide students in the development of their character and academic potential through academically rigorous, content-rich educational programs. Our K-12 schools (James Irwin Charter High School, James Irwin Charter Middle School, James Irwin Elementary-Astrozon and James Irwin Elementary-Howard) have been recognized nationally, statewide and locally for academic excellence and achievement. Beginning with our academic “College Kindergarten” and culminating in our rigorous, college-preparatory high school, the schools’ mission and passion are to provide the highest quality education while developing the character of its students. James Irwin Charter Schools opened its fifth school, Power Technical in the fall of 2016. This grades 6-14 vocational school is for students interested in construction or manufacturing. Through a partnership with Pikes Peak Community College, El Paso County School District 49, the Housing and Building Association and multiple manufacturers, Power Technical will pay for its students to earn an Associate’s Degree in a skilled trade.
